import Image from "../Ui/Image"; import { Student } from "../../types/Item"; import { useNavigate, useParams } from "react-router-dom"; import { useGetStudent } from "../../api/student"; import { useTranslation } from "react-i18next"; const StudentBehavior = () => { const { student_id } = useParams(); const { data: studentData } = useGetStudent({ show: student_id, }); const userData: Student | {} = studentData?.data ?? {}; const { positiveNote, warningNote, alertNote } = userData as Student; const [t] = useTranslation(); const navigate = useNavigate(); const handelnavigate = () => { navigate(`note`); }; const Data = [ { icon: "/Icon/medal.png", title: t("array.UserInfo.appreciation"), value: positiveNote, buttonText: t("practical.show"), }, { icon: "/Icon/warning.png", title: t("array.UserInfo.warning"), value: warningNote, buttonText: t("practical.show"), }, { icon: "/Icon/Error.png", title: t("array.UserInfo.alert"), value: alertNote, buttonText: t("practical.show"), }, ]; return (
{t("header.Student_classroom_behavior")}
{Data.map((item, index) => (
{item.title}

{item.value}

))}
); }; export default StudentBehavior;